
body { 
	background-color: #FFFFFF;
	background-position: top center;
	background-image: url(/skins/new/banniere.png);
	background-repeat: no-repeat;
	margin-top:0px;
	margin-bottom:0px;
	margin-left:0px;
	margin-right:0px;
	padding:0;
	border:0;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-style:normal;
	font-size:12px;}

table { font-size:12px; }
.couleurclaire { color:#FF9000; }

#champConnexion { 
	position:absolute;
	z-index:15; 
	width:500px; 
	height:39px;
	overflow:hidden;
	top:0px; 
	right:0px; 
	font-size:10px;
	background-image:url(/skins/new/connexion.png); }

#champDeconnexion { 
	position:absolute;
	z-index:15; 
	width:500px; 
	height:39px; 
	top:0px; 
	right:0px; 
	font-size:10px;
	background-image:url(/skins/new/deconnexion.png); } 
#champSearch { 
	position:absolute; 
	z-index:22; 
	width:156px; 
	height:26px; 
	top:73px; 
	left:50%;
	margin-left:330px;
	background-image:url(/skins/new/fondSearch.png); }

#loupeSearch { 
	position:absolute; 
	z-index:24; 
	width:17px; 
	height:17px; 
	top:75px; 
	left:50%;
	margin-left:460px; }

#logoBeta { 
	position:absolute; 
	z-index:15; 
	width:90px; 
	height:90px; 
	top:0px; 
	left:0px; 
	 }

.CasesConnection {
	border:1px solid #999999;
}

div#menu{z-index:15; position:absolute; width:990px; top:78px; left:50%; margin-left:-595px;}
ul#nav,ul#nav li{list-style-type:none; margin:0; padding:0; background:#FFA000;}
ul#nav{margin-left:100px; width:650px;}
ul#nav li{float:left; margin-right: 3px; text-align: center;}
ul#nav a{float:left; width:7em; padding: 5px 0; background:#FFD795; text-decoration:none; color:#000}
ul#nav a:hover{background: #FFDDCC;}
ul#nav li.activelink a,ul#nav li.activelink a:hover { background: #FFDDCC;; font-weight:bold;}
ul#nav li#insc a { color:#FF0000; }

#bienvenue { 
	z-index:20; 
	position:absolute; 
	left:50%; 
	top:125px; 
	height:234px; 
	width:605px; 
	margin-left:-495px; 
	background: #E4E4E4 url(/skins/new/box1-fond.png) repeat-x; 
	padding:0px 0px 0px 0px; }
#bienvenueHG { position:absolute; left:0px; top:0px; background:url(/skins/new/box1-HG.png) repeat-x; width:25px; height:35px;}
#bienvenueHD { position:absolute; right:0px; top:0px; background:url(/skins/new/box1-HD.png) repeat-x; width:25px; height:35px;}
#bienvenueBG { position:absolute; left:0px; bottom:0px; background:url(/skins/new/box1-BG.png) repeat-x; width:25px; height:21px;}
#bienvenueBD { position:absolute; right:0px; bottom:0px; background:url(/skins/new/box1-BD.png) repeat-x; width:25px; height:21px;}
#bienvenueTitre { position:absolute; right:0px; top:4px; color:FFBA6F; font-weight:bold; width:100%; text-align:center;}
#bienvenueContenu { position:absolute; margin-top:20px; z-index:22; top:20px; left:25px;}

#retoucheDemo { 
	z-index:20; 
	position:absolute; 
	left:50%; 
	top:125px; 
	height: 234px; 
	width:370px; 
	margin-left:125px; 
	background: #FFAE4D url(/skins/new/box2-fond.png) repeat-x; 
	padding:0px 0px 0px 0px; 
	text-align:center;}
#retoucheDemoHG { position:absolute; left:0px; top:0px; background:url(/skins/new/box2-HG.png) repeat-x; width:25px; height:35px;}
#retoucheDemoHD { position:absolute; right:0px; top:0px; background:url(/skins/new/box2-HD.png) repeat-x; width:25px; height:35px;}
#retoucheDemoBG { position:absolute; left:0px; bottom:0px; background:url(/skins/new/box2-BG.png) repeat-x; width:25px; height:21px;}
#retoucheDemoBD { position:absolute; right:0px; bottom:0px; background:url(/skins/new/box2-BD.png) repeat-x; width:25px; height:21px;}
#retoucheDemoTitre { position:absolute; right:0px; top:4px; font-weight:bold; width:100%; text-align:center; }
#retoucheDemoContenu { position:absolute; z-index:22; right:0px; top:26px; width:100%;}



#dernieresGaleries {
	z-index:20; 
	position:absolute; 
	left:50%; 
	top:375px; 
	height: 152px; 
	width:990px; 
	margin-left:-495px;
	background: #FFFFFF url(/skins/new/box3-fond.png) repeat-x; 
	padding:0px 0px 0px; 
	text-align:center;}
#dernieresGaleriesHG { position:absolute; left:0px; top:0px; background:url(/skins/new/box3-HG.png) repeat-x; width:25px; height:35px;}
#dernieresGaleriesHD { position:absolute; right:0px; top:0px; background:url(/skins/new/box3-HD.png) repeat-x; width:25px; height:35px;}
#dernieresGaleriesBG { position:absolute; left:0px; bottom:0px; background:url(/skins/new/box3-BG.png) repeat-x; width:25px; height:21px;}
#dernieresGaleriesBD { position:absolute; right:0px; bottom:0px; background:url(/skins/new/box3-BD.png) repeat-x; width:25px; height:21px;}
#dernieresGaleriesTitre { position:absolute; right:0px; top:4px; font-weight:bold; width:100%; text-align:center; }
#dernieresGaleriesContenu { position:absolute; z-index:22; right:0px; top:40px; width:100%; height:100%; margin-top:-3px; }

#derniersThemes { 
	z-index:20; 
	position:absolute; 
	left:50%; 
	top:542px; 
	height:312px; 
	width:710px; 
	margin-left:-495px; 
	background: #CCC8FC url(/skins/new/box4-fond.png) repeat-x; 
	padding:0px 0px 0px; }
#derniersThemesHG { position:absolute; left:0px; top:0px; background:url(/skins/new/box4-HG.png) repeat-x; width:25px; height:35px;}
#derniersThemesHD { position:absolute; right:0px; top:0px; background:url(/skins/new/box4-HD.png) repeat-x; width:25px; height:35px;}
#derniersThemesBG { position:absolute; left:0px; bottom:0px; background:url(/skins/new/box4-BG.png) repeat-x; width:25px; height:21px;}
#derniersThemesBD { position:absolute; right:0px; bottom:0px; background:url(/skins/new/box4-BD.png) repeat-x; width:25px; height:21px;}
#derniersThemesTitre { position:absolute; right:0px; top:4px; font-weight:bold; width:100%; text-align:center; }
#derniersThemesContenu { position:absolute; z-index:22; right:0px; top:30px; width:100%;}


#moreThemes { 
	z-index:20; 
	position:absolute; 
	left:50%; 
	top:542px; 
	height:312px; 
	width:266px; 
	margin-left:229px; 
	background: #FFAE4D url(/skins/new/box5-fond.png) repeat-x; 
	padding:0px 0px 0px; 
	text-align:center;}
#moreThemesHG { position:absolute; left:0px; top:0px; background:url(/skins/new/box5-HG.png) repeat-x; width:25px; height:35px;}
#moreThemesHD { position:absolute; right:0px; top:0px; background:url(/skins/new/box5-HD.png) repeat-x; width:25px; height:35px;}
#moreThemesBG { position:absolute; left:0px; bottom:0px; background:url(/skins/new/box5-BG.png) repeat-x; width:25px; height:21px;}
#moreThemesBD { position:absolute; right:0px; bottom:0px; background:url(/skins/new/box5-BD.png) repeat-x; width:25px; height:21px;}
#moreThemesTitre { position:absolute; color:FFBA6F; right:0px; top:4px; font-weight:bold; width:100%; text-align:center; }
#moreThemesContenu { position:absolute; z-index:22; right:0px; top:20px; width:100%; }

#pubsIndex {
	z-index:20; 
	position:absolute; 
	left:50%; 
	top:869px; 
	height: 60px; 
	width:990px;
	margin-left:-495px;
	padding:0px 0px 0px; 
	text-align:center;
}

#footer {
	z-index:20; 
	position:absolute; 
	left:50%; 
	top:944px; 
	height: 23px; 
	width:990px;
	margin-left:-495px;
	background: #FFFFFF url(/skins/new/box5-fond.png) repeat-x; 
	padding:0px 0px 0px; 
	text-align:center;}
#footerHG { position:absolute; left:0px; top:0px; background:url(/skins/new/box5-HG.png) repeat-x; width:25px; height:23px;}
#footerHD { position:absolute; right:0px; top:0px; background:url(/skins/new/box5-HD.png) repeat-x; width:25px; height:23px;}
#footerTitre { position:absolute; right:0px; top:4px; color:FFBA6F; width:100%; text-align:center; }

#centrale {
	z-index:20; 
	position:relative; 
	left:50%;
	height:auto;
	margin-top: 125px;
	width:990px;
	margin-left: -495px;
	background: #CCC8FC url(/skins/new/box3-fond.png) repeat-x;
	padding:0px 0px 0px 0px; 
	text-align:center; 
	float:left;}
#centraleHG { position:absolute; left:0px; top:0px; background:url(/skins/new/box3-HG.png) repeat-x; width:25px; height:35px;}
#centraleHD { position:absolute; right:0px; top:0px; background:url(/skins/new/box3-HD.png) repeat-x; width:25px; height:35px;}
#centraleBG { position:absolute; left:0px; bottom:0px; background:url(/skins/new/box3-BG.png) repeat-x; width:25px; height:21px;}
#centraleBD { position:absolute; right:0px; bottom:0px; background:url(/skins/new/box3-BD.png) repeat-x; width:25px; height:21px;}
#centraleTitre { position:absolute; right:0px; top:4px; font-weight:bold; width:100%; text-align:center; }
#centraleContenu { position:relative; padding-top:30px; width:100%; }

#texte_bas { text-align:center; }

#pages_droite {
	z-index:20; 
	position:relative; 
	left:50%;
	height:auto;
	margin-top:105px;
	width:790px;
	margin-left:-294px; 
	background: #CCC8FC url(/skins/new/box3-fond.png) repeat-x;
	padding:0px 0px 0px; 
	text-align:center; }
#pages_droiteHG { position:absolute; left:0px; top:0px; background:url(/skins/new/box3-HG.png) repeat-x; width:25px; height:35px;}
#pages_droiteHD { position:absolute; right:0px; top:0px; background:url(/skins/new/box3-HD.png) repeat-x; width:25px; height:35px;}
#pages_droiteBG { position:absolute; left:0px; bottom:0px; background:url(/skins/new/box3-BG.png) repeat-x; width:25px; height:21px;}
#pages_droiteBD { position:absolute; right:0px; bottom:0px; background:url(/skins/new/box3-BD.png) repeat-x; width:25px; height:21px;}
#pages_droiteTitre { position:absolute; right:0px; top:4px; font-weight:bold; width:100%; text-align:center; }
#pages_droiteContenu { position:relative; padding-top:30px; width:100%; }

#bullesMenu {
	z-index:20; 
	position:relative; 
	left:50%;
	margin-top:105px;
	width:186px;
	margin-left:-495px; 
	padding:0px 0px 0px 0px; 
	text-align:center;
	float:left;
}

#pages_bulleMenu1 { position:relative; background: #CCC8FC url(/skins/new/box3-fond.png) repeat-x;	padding:0px 0px 0px; width:99%;}
#pages_bulleMenu1HG { position:absolute; left:0px; top:0px; background:url(/skins/new/box3-HG.png) repeat-x; width:25px; height:35px;}
#pages_bulleMenu1HD { position:absolute; right:0px; top:0px; background:url(/skins/new/box3-HD.png) repeat-x; width:25px; height:35px;}
#pages_bulleMenu1BG { position:absolute; left:0px; bottom:0px; background:url(/skins/new/box3-BG.png) repeat-x; width:25px; height:21px;}
#pages_bulleMenu1BD { position:absolute; right:0px; bottom:0px; background:url(/skins/new/box3-BD.png) repeat-x; width:25px; height:21px;}
#pages_bulleMenu1Titre { position:absolute; right:0px; top:4px; font-weight:bold; width:100%; text-align:center; }
#pages_bulleMenu1Contenu { position:relative; padding-top:30px; width:100%;}


#pages_bulleMenu2 { position:relative; background: #CCC8FC url(/skins/new/box3-fond.png) repeat-x;	padding:0px 0px 0px; width:99%; }
#pages_bulleMenu2HG { position:absolute; left:0px; top:0px; background:url(/skins/new/box3-HG.png) repeat-x; width:25px; height:35px;}
#pages_bulleMenu2HD { position:absolute; right:0px; top:0px; background:url(/skins/new/box3-HD.png) repeat-x; width:25px; height:35px;}
#pages_bulleMenu2BG { position:absolute; left:0px; bottom:0px; background:url(/skins/new/box3-BG.png) repeat-x; width:25px; height:21px;}
#pages_bulleMenu2BD { position:absolute; right:0px; bottom:0px; background:url(/skins/new/box3-BD.png) repeat-x; width:25px; height:21px;}
#pages_bulleMenu2Titre { position:absolute; right:0px; top:4px; font-weight:bold; width:100%; text-align:center; }
#pages_bulleMenu2Contenu { position:relative; padding-top:30px; width:100%; min-height:115px;}


#pages_bulleMenu3 { position:relative; background: #CCC8FC url(/skins/new/box3-fond.png) repeat-x;	padding:0px 0px 0px; width:99%; }
#pages_bulleMenu3HG { position:absolute; left:0px; top:0px; background:url(/skins/new/box3-HG.png) repeat-x; width:25px; height:35px;}
#pages_bulleMenu3HD { position:absolute; right:0px; top:0px; background:url(/skins/new/box3-HD.png) repeat-x; width:25px; height:35px;}
#pages_bulleMenu3BG { position:absolute; left:0px; bottom:0px; background:url(/skins/new/box3-BG.png) repeat-x; width:25px; height:21px;}
#pages_bulleMenu3BD { position:absolute; right:0px; bottom:0px; background:url(/skins/new/box3-BD.png) repeat-x; width:25px; height:21px;}
#pages_bulleMenu3Titre { position:absolute; right:0px; top:4px; font-weight:bold; width:100%; text-align:center; }
#pages_bulleMenu3Contenu { position:relative; padding-top:30px; width:100%; min-height:115px;}


.fondListeGaleries { background-color:#ECEAFE; border:1px solid #FFCC33; }

.tableauMessages { border-spacing: 0px; border-collapse: collapse; font-size:12px; }
.tableauMessages td { border-bottom: 1px solid #888; }
.tableauMessages a { cursor:pointer; color:#E06600; text-decoration:none;}
.tableauMessages a:hover { text-decoration:underline; }



	